      "Almost no one thought Joe Biden could make it back to the White House--not Donald Trump, not the two dozen Democratic rivals who sought to take down a weak front-runner, not the mega-donors and key endorsers who feared he could not beat Bernie Sanders, not even Barack Obama. The story of Biden's cathartic victory in the 2020 election is the story of a Democratic Party at odds with itself, torn between the single-minded goal of removing Donald Trump and the push for a bold progressive agenda that threatened to alienate as many voters as it drew"-- Amazon.com

      #1 NEW YORK TIMES BESTSELLER It was never supposed to be this close. And of course she was supposed to win. How Hillary Clinton lost the 2016 election to Donald Trump is the riveting story of a sure thing gone off the rails. For every Comey revelation or hindsight acknowledgment about the electorate, no explanation of defeat can begin with anything other than the core problem of Hillary's campaign--the candidate herself. Through deep access to insiders from the top to the bottom of the campaign, political writers Jonathan Allen and Amie Parnes have reconstructed the key decisions and unseized opportunities, the well-intentioned misfires and the hidden thorns that turned a winnable contest into a devastating loss. Drawing on the authors' deep knowledge of Hillary from their previous book, the acclaimed biography HRC, Shattered offers an object lesson in how Hillary herself made victory an uphill battle, how her difficulty articulating a vision irreparably hobbled her impact with voters, and how the campaign failed to internalize the lessons of populist fury from the hard-fought primary against Bernie Sanders. Moving blow-by-blow from the campaign's difficult birth through the bewildering terror of election night, Shattered tells an unforgettable story with urgent lessons both political and personal, filled with revelations that will change the way readers understand just what happened to America on November 8, 2016.

      Was machen die Tiere, wenn der Schnee kommt? Das kleine Yak lebt hoch oben in den Bergen mit seiner Mutter und der Herde. Der Winter steht vor der Tür. Klein Yak hat noch nie Schnee gesehen. Es fragt Freund Pika, einen Pfeifhasen, was er im Winter macht. Pika hat Gras gesammelt und genügend Futter für den Winter parat. »Oh«, meint das kleine Yak und geht weiter, zur Blaumerle. Die erzählt ihm, dass sie im Winter mit ihren Freunden gegen Süden fliegt. So fragt das kleine Yak noch weitere Freunde. Es erzählt der Mutter, was es gehört hat. »Müssen wir auch Gras sammeln? Oder weggehen?« »Nein«, sagt die Mama, »wir bleiben da, wo wir sind. Wir haben ein dickes, zotteliges Fell, das hält uns warm.« »Yaks haben Glück, wenn der Schnee kommt«, freut sich das kleine Yak. »Wieso meinst du?«, fragt die Mama. »Nur wir sehen den wunderschönen Schnee!«
